How to protect keratin treated hair from heat?
To further protect your keratin-treated hair from the rigors of heat styling tools, use a heat protection styling spray to shield your hair. A heat protection spray will work to prevent direct heat on the keratin coating, thus preventing it from melting.

Why do clarifying shampoos work?
Because clarifying shampoos work at high pH to open the cuticles and deep cleanse. When your hair cuticles are open, alkaline water dissolves the keratin and allows them to escape from the shafts, therefore fading your keratin treatment fast. Use gentle shampoos with low pH levels.

How to get rid of hair creases after washing?
Do Not Rub Your Hair With A Towel After Wash. Avoid friction from towel in your hair. A rough cotton towel creates crease in your hair. Use a microfiber towel instead to gently dry your hair. Microfiber towels are super absorbent, and they quickly grab all the excess water from your wet hair without rubbing.
What pillowcases make your hair crease?
Cotton pillowcases make your hair crease. They also absorb moisture to leave your tresses frizzy and dry. Moreover, the fabric also causes friction in your hair which results in tangles and knots. If you want smooth and tangle-free hair when you wake up, invest in a silk or satin pillowcase instead.
When is the best time to color your hair?
The best time to color your hair is before your keratin treatment. That’s because keratin seals the color in nicely and provides a protective coating to stop your hair color from fading. However, if you do it within 3 weeks after your treatment, the hair dye will struggle to penetrate into your hair.
Does salt shampoo dissolve keratin?
Using salt-based shampoos will dissolve the keratin coating and wash out your expensive treatment prematurely. Oouch! For lasting results, post-treatment shampoo should be free of sulfates (sudsing agents that can strip hair) or sodium (a thickener that dissolves keratin) Emma Froelich.
